+/* Output PHI function PHI to the main stream in OB.  */
+
+static void
+output_phi (struct output_block *ob, gphi *phi)
+{
+  unsigned i, len = gimple_phi_num_args (phi);
+
+  streamer_write_record_start (ob, lto_gimple_code_to_tag (GIMPLE_PHI));
+  streamer_write_uhwi (ob, SSA_NAME_VERSION (PHI_RESULT (phi)));
+
+  for (i = 0; i < len; i++)
+    {
+      stream_write_tree (ob, gimple_phi_arg_def (phi, i), true);
+      streamer_write_uhwi (ob, gimple_phi_arg_edge (phi, i)->src->index);
+      bitpack_d bp = bitpack_create (ob->main_stream);
+      stream_output_location (ob, &bp, gimple_phi_arg_location (phi, i));
+      streamer_write_bitpack (&bp);
+    }
+}

+/* Emit statement STMT on the main stream of output block OB.  */
+
+static void
+output_gimple_stmt (struct output_block *ob, gimple *stmt)
+{
+  unsigned i;
+  enum gimple_code code;
+  enum LTO_tags tag;
+  struct bitpack_d bp;
+  histogram_value hist;
+
+  /* Emit identifying tag.  */
+  code = gimple_code (stmt);
+  tag = lto_gimple_code_to_tag (code);
+  streamer_write_record_start (ob, tag);
+
+  /* Emit the tuple header.  */
+  bp = bitpack_create (ob->main_stream);
+  bp_pack_var_len_unsigned (&bp, gimple_num_ops (stmt));
+  bp_pack_value (&bp, gimple_no_warning_p (stmt), 1);
+  if (is_gimple_assign (stmt))
+    bp_pack_value (&bp,
+		   gimple_assign_nontemporal_move_p (
+		     as_a <gassign *> (stmt)),
+		   1);
+  bp_pack_value (&bp, gimple_has_volatile_ops (stmt), 1);
+  hist = gimple_histogram_value (cfun, stmt);
+  bp_pack_value (&bp, hist != NULL, 1);
+  bp_pack_var_len_unsigned (&bp, stmt->subcode);
+
+  /* Emit location information for the statement.  */
+  stream_output_location (ob, &bp, LOCATION_LOCUS (gimple_location (stmt)));
+  streamer_write_bitpack (&bp);
+
+  /* Emit the lexical block holding STMT.  */
+  stream_write_tree (ob, gimple_block (stmt), true);
+
+  /* Emit the operands.  */
+  switch (gimple_code (stmt))
+    {
+    case GIMPLE_RESX:
+      streamer_write_hwi (ob, gimple_resx_region (as_a <gresx *> (stmt)));
+      break;
+
+    case GIMPLE_EH_MUST_NOT_THROW:
+      stream_write_tree (ob,
+			 gimple_eh_must_not_throw_fndecl (
+			   as_a <geh_mnt *> (stmt)),
+			 true);
+      break;
+
+    case GIMPLE_EH_DISPATCH:
+      streamer_write_hwi (ob,
+			  gimple_eh_dispatch_region (
+			    as_a <geh_dispatch *> (stmt)));
+      break;
+
+    case GIMPLE_ASM:
+      {
+	gasm *asm_stmt = as_a <gasm *> (stmt);
+	streamer_write_uhwi (ob, gimple_asm_ninputs (asm_stmt));
+	streamer_write_uhwi (ob, gimple_asm_noutputs (asm_stmt));
+	streamer_write_uhwi (ob, gimple_asm_nclobbers (asm_stmt));
+	streamer_write_uhwi (ob, gimple_asm_nlabels (asm_stmt));
+	streamer_write_string (ob, ob->main_stream,
+			       gimple_asm_string (asm_stmt), true);
+      }
+      /* Fallthru  */
+
+    case GIMPLE_ASSIGN:
+    case GIMPLE_CALL:
+    case GIMPLE_RETURN:
+    case GIMPLE_SWITCH:
+    case GIMPLE_LABEL:
+    case GIMPLE_COND:
+    case GIMPLE_GOTO:
+    case GIMPLE_DEBUG:
+      for (i = 0; i < gimple_num_ops (stmt); i++)
+	{
+	  tree op = gimple_op (stmt, i);
+	  tree *basep = NULL;
+	  /* Wrap all uses of non-automatic variables inside MEM_REFs
+	     so that we do not have to deal with type mismatches on
+	     merged symbols during IL read in.  The first operand
+	     of GIMPLE_DEBUG must be a decl, not MEM_REF, though.  */
+	  if (op && (i || !is_gimple_debug (stmt)))
+	    {
+	      basep = &op;
+	      if (TREE_CODE (*basep) == ADDR_EXPR)
+		basep = &TREE_OPERAND (*basep, 0);
+	      while (handled_component_p (*basep))
+		basep = &TREE_OPERAND (*basep, 0);
+	      if (VAR_P (*basep)
+		  && !auto_var_in_fn_p (*basep, current_function_decl)
+		  && !DECL_REGISTER (*basep))
+		{
+		  bool volatilep = TREE_THIS_VOLATILE (*basep);
+		  tree ptrtype = build_pointer_type (TREE_TYPE (*basep));
+		  *basep = build2 (MEM_REF, TREE_TYPE (*basep),
+				   build1 (ADDR_EXPR, ptrtype, *basep),
+				   build_int_cst (ptrtype, 0));
+		  TREE_THIS_VOLATILE (*basep) = volatilep;
+		}
+	      else
+		basep = NULL;
+	    }
+	  stream_write_tree (ob, op, true);
+	  /* Restore the original base if we wrapped it inside a MEM_REF.  */
+	  if (basep)
+	    *basep = TREE_OPERAND (TREE_OPERAND (*basep, 0), 0);
+	}
+      if (is_gimple_call (stmt))
+	{
+	  if (gimple_call_internal_p (stmt))
+	    streamer_write_enum (ob->main_stream, internal_fn,
+				 IFN_LAST, gimple_call_internal_fn (stmt));
+	  else
+	    stream_write_tree (ob, gimple_call_fntype (stmt), true);
+	}
+      break;
+
+    case GIMPLE_NOP:
+    case GIMPLE_PREDICT:
+      break;
+
+    case GIMPLE_TRANSACTION:
+      {
+	gtransaction *txn = as_a <gtransaction *> (stmt);
+	gcc_assert (gimple_transaction_body (txn) == NULL);
+	stream_write_tree (ob, gimple_transaction_label_norm (txn), true);
+	stream_write_tree (ob, gimple_transaction_label_uninst (txn), true);
+	stream_write_tree (ob, gimple_transaction_label_over (txn), true);
+      }
+      break;
+
+    default:
+      gcc_unreachable ();
+    }
+  if (hist)
+    stream_out_histogram_value (ob, hist);
+}

+/* Output a basic block BB to the main stream in OB for this FN.  */
+
+void
+output_bb (struct output_block *ob, basic_block bb, struct function *fn)
+{
+  gimple_stmt_iterator bsi = gsi_start_bb (bb);
+
+  streamer_write_record_start (ob,
+			       (!gsi_end_p (bsi)) || phi_nodes (bb)
+			        ? LTO_bb1
+				: LTO_bb0);
+
+  streamer_write_uhwi (ob, bb->index);
+  bb->count.stream_out (ob);
+  streamer_write_hwi (ob, bb->frequency);
+  streamer_write_hwi (ob, bb->flags);
+
+  if (!gsi_end_p (bsi) || phi_nodes (bb))
+    {
+      /* Output the statements.  The list of statements is terminated
+	 with a zero.  */
+      for (bsi = gsi_start_bb (bb); !gsi_end_p (bsi); gsi_next (&bsi))
+	{
+	  int region;
+	  gimple *stmt = gsi_stmt (bsi);
+
+	  output_gimple_stmt (ob, stmt);
+
+	  /* Emit the EH region holding STMT.  */
+	  region = lookup_stmt_eh_lp_fn (fn, stmt);
+	  if (region != 0)
+	    {
+	      streamer_write_record_start (ob, LTO_eh_region);
+	      streamer_write_hwi (ob, region);
+	    }
+	  else
+	    streamer_write_record_start (ob, LTO_null);
+	}
+
+      streamer_write_record_start (ob, LTO_null);
+
+      for (gphi_iterator psi = gsi_start_phis (bb);
+	   !gsi_end_p (psi);
+	   gsi_next (&psi))
+	{
+	  gphi *phi = psi.phi ();
+
+	  /* Only emit PHIs for gimple registers.  PHI nodes for .MEM
+	     will be filled in on reading when the SSA form is
+	     updated.  */
+	  if (!virtual_operand_p (gimple_phi_result (phi)))
+	    output_phi (ob, phi);
+	}
+
+      streamer_write_record_start (ob, LTO_null);
+    }
+}
